The Village of Norman had a population of 40 as of July 1, 2023.
The primary coordinate point for Norman is located at latitude 40.4797 and longitude -98.7923 in Kearney County. The formal boundaries for the Village of Norman encompass a land area of 0.09 sq. miles and a water area of 0 sq. miles. Kearney County is in the Central time zone (GMT -6).
The Village of Norman has a C1 Census Class Code which indicates an active incorporated place that does not serve as a county subdivision equivalent. It also has a Functional Status Code of "A" which identifies an active government providing primary general-purpose functions.
The Village of Norman is located within Township of May, a minor civil division (MCD) of Kearney County.
